Capiz police celebrates PCR Month

The month of July is celebrated nationwide by the Philippine National Police as Police Community Relations Month.

In line with this,  the Capiz Police Provincial Office (CPPO) has conducted series of activities with various sectors.

This include the Journalism Enhancement Seminar as a joint endeavor with the Capiz Times Publishing, and the Capiz Provincial Advisory Group, conducted on July 27 at the CPPO Transformation Hall, Brgy. Lanot, Road City.

Participants were Police Community Relation Officers in every police station from the municipalities of Capiz and Roxas City.

CPPO under its director, Col. Jerome Apuyog, Jr., and Edalyn  Acta, operations manager of Capiz Times, have designed the seminar to impart to the police the strategy in news writing and photo stories.

Topics include digital photography by Paula Jane Acta; photo journalism/captioning by Edith Colmo; and news writing by Virgilio Clavel, all of Capiz Times; video editing by Pat. Jessie Rey Catalogo, assistant PIO; social media by SSg. Andy Delena, PIO, CPPO;  and information development operation by Maj Ruby  Magallanes,  Asst. PCADU/PIO, all of CPPO.

According to Maj. Magallanes, the seminar will further enhance the skills of the police community relation officers being the frontliners in the community.

Other activities during the PCR Month Celebration include tree planting which was participated by different sectors.*
